Question to the Department for Environment, Food and Rural Affairs:

To ask the Secretary of State for Environment, Food and Rural Affairs, what steps he is taking to increase the sustainability of fisheries.

The Fisheries Act’s objectives, together with the strong legal framework of the Joint Fisheries Statement and Fisheries Management Plans, set out our commitment to achieving sustainable fishing and protecting the marine environment. We will also work closely with neighbouring countries to ensure our seas are managed sustainably, to secure a fair share of quota for UK fishers, and to enable a thriving industry for current and future generations. Our ambition remains to have world-class fisheries management that delivers sustainable fisheries, safeguards stocks and the environment for the long-term.
